# Project Kick-off Brief - Financial Services

## Purpose
Prepare and distribute before every project kick-off meeting to align the team and set the project up for success.

## When to Use
A one-page project brief for kick-off meetings covering objectives, scope, team roles, key milestones, communication plan, and success criteria.

## Instructions
1. Review the template below and familiarise yourself with the structure
2. Replace all [bracketed placeholders] with your financial services business details
3. Customise the tone and formatting to match your brand
4. Save in your preferred tool (Notion or Asana)

# Project Kick-off Brief

**Project Name:** [Project Name]
**Client/Sponsor:** [Client Name or Internal Sponsor]
**Project Lead:** [Name]
**Start Date:** [Date]
**Target Completion:** [Date]
**Budget:** $[Amount] (ex. GST)

---

## 1. Project Objective

[Two to three sentences describing what the project aims to achieve and why it matters. For example: "This project will implement an automated client onboarding workflow that reduces manual data entry by 80% and ensures every new client receives a consistent, high-quality welcome experience within 24 hours of signing."]

---

## 2. Scope

**In Scope:**
- [Deliverable 1]
- [Deliverable 2]
- [Deliverable 3]
- [Deliverable 4]

**Out of Scope:**
- [Item 1 that will NOT be included]
- [Item 2 that will NOT be included]

---

## 3. Team and Roles

| Team Member | Role | Responsibilities |
|-------------|------|-----------------|
| [Name] | Project Lead | Overall delivery, client liaison, risk management |
| [Name] | [Role, e.g. Developer] | [Key responsibilities] |
| [Name] | [Role, e.g. Designer] | [Key responsibilities] |
| [Name] | Client Contact | Approvals, feedback, providing required assets |

---

## 4. Key Milestones

| Milestone | Target Date | Dependencies |
|-----------|-------------|-------------|
| Project kick-off | [Date] | None |
| [Phase 1 deliverable] | [Date] | [Any dependencies] |
| [Phase 2 deliverable] | [Date] | [Any dependencies] |
| Client review and feedback | [Date] | Phase 2 completion |
| Final delivery / go-live | [Date] | Client sign-off |

---

## 5. Communication Plan

- **Status updates:** [Frequency, e.g. "Weekly on Fridays via email"]
- **Team check-ins:** [Frequency and format, e.g. "Daily 15-minute standup at 9:15 AM"]
- **Client meetings:** [Frequency, e.g. "Fortnightly via Zoom"]
- **Primary channel:** [e.g. "Slack #project-[name]"]
- **Escalation path:** [Name] (Project Lead) then [Name] (Director)

---

## 6. Success Criteria

This project will be considered successful when:
- [Measurable outcome 1, e.g. "Onboarding time is reduced from 3 days to under 24 hours"]
- [Measurable outcome 2, e.g. "All integrations pass quality assurance testing"]
- [Measurable outcome 3, e.g. "Client signs off on all deliverables"]

---

## 7. Risks and Mitigations

| Risk | Likelihood | Impact | Mitigation |
|------|-----------|--------|------------|
| [Risk 1] | [High/Med/Low] | [High/Med/Low] | [Mitigation strategy] |
| [Risk 2] | [High/Med/Low] | [High/Med/Low] | [Mitigation strategy] |

---
